How Does An Mri Work A Straightforward Breakdown Revolutionized Mris employ powerful magnets which produce a strong magnetic field that forces protons in the body to align with that field. when a radiofrequency current is then pulsed through the patient, the protons are stimulated, and spin out of equilibrium, straining against the pull of the magnetic field. How Does An Mri Work A Straightforward Breakdown Revolutionized Magnetic resonance imaging (mri) is a medical imaging technique used in radiology to generate pictures of the anatomy and the physiological processes inside the body. mri scanners use strong magnetic fields, magnetic field gradients, and radio waves to form images of the organs in the body. How does an mri machine work? the body contains abundant amounts of particles known as protons that respond to an mri machine’s magnetic fields and radio waves. during an mri scan, the protons release signals that provide information about the inside of the body. Magnetic resonance imaging (mri) is a non invasive diagnostic tool that enables medical professionals to capture highly detailed images of the inside of the body. unlike x rays or ct scans, mri uses powerful magnets and radio waves, rather than radiation, making it a safer option for repeated use.
